Lorimers

I heard on the Oxted grapevine the other day that a new Sainsburys local is going to open on the high street. On Monday, James wandered over to J H Lorimers to buy some paint only to discover that they were in the process of moving across the road to where the card shop 'Something Special' used to be; an interesting choice because it's a much smaller building. We reckon the new Sainburys must have paid off Lorimers to shift premises, so that they can nab the bigger building! It's a shame actually because they now only stock half the things they did before, and have completely done away with their toys section, and modelling paints! Noo! I'm going to have to go to Croydon for those now! What they actually appear to have done is merged the two shops together, so now its pretty much the same as Sussex stationers, only without the books. I just hope this isn't a sign of Oxted changing in the same way that Reigate did, into a giant eatery. Hmm.. oh well, it might be nice to have a Sainsburys down the road I guess!
